I have decoupled the page selector field into a sample control that you can use instead of the built in field.
Add the attached PageSelectorSample project to the sitefinty project and visual studio and it have added references to Sitefinity 5.3 assemblies (change the PageSelectorProject Telerik references if you want to use the field in different sitefinity version (5.4.4020).
To use the field build in visual studio and it will generate PageSelectorSample.dll, add reference to the project .dll in your sitefinity site and build it. To use the control:
1. Add Global.asax to the project and in it register the PageSelectorSample dialog that will open for selecting pages.
sender, EventArgs e)
sender, Telerik.Sitefinity.Data.ExecutedEventArgs e)
Go to Administration->Settings->Advanced->VirtualPathSettings->VirtualPaths on the right click create new and enter
save changes and restart the application for the virtual path to be in use otherwise the same error will be thrown.
Create a custom field of type : PageSelectorSample.PageSelector
You might find the sample useful in your case.
the Telerik team
Do you want to have your say in the Sitefinity development roadmap? Do you want to know when a feature you requested is added or when a bug fixed? Explore the Telerik Public Issue Tracking
system and vote to affect the priority of the items